Two "Site Health" Issues

Home Forums Jevelin Theme Two “Site Health” Issues

Home Forums Jevelin Theme Two “Site Health” Issues

Viewing 16 posts - 1 through 16 (of 16 total)
  • Author
    RESOLVED Posts
  • ScienceofRowing
    Participant

    I have a message that “jQuery Migrate Helper — Warnings encountered
    This page generated the following warnings:

    jQuery.fn.load() is deprecated
    Please make sure you are using the latest version of all of your plugins, and your theme. If you are, you may want to ask the developers of the code mentioned in the warnings for an update.”

     

    All of our plugins are updated and we are using Jevelin 4.7.1 on WordPress 5.5

     

    I have one “critical” site health issue: “An active PHP session was detected. A PHP session was created by a session_start() function call. This interferes with REST API and loopback requests. The session should be closed by session_write_close() before making any HTTP requests.”

     

    This appeared around the time of the WordPress 5.5 update and subsequent theme updates. We contacted our hosting provider and they were not able to help us. Is this an error on the host side (in which case I need to press hosting provider more into helping us) or on the theme/Wordpress side? I am having trouble finding where to start solving this problem.

     

    Can you please advise on these issues?

    Attachments:
    You must be logged in to view attached files.

    Solution for this topic

    Hi @ScienceofRowing,

     

    I hope you are well today and thank you for your question.

     

    It seems you are using an older version of the theme on your website so please update it to the below latest version as described here https://support.shufflehound.com/updating-theme/

     


    Please login to access this file

     

    This can be due to plugin conflict on your site so please try temporarily deactivating all plugins except Unyson, Redux framework, and WpBakery page builder plugins and see whether everything works fine and then enable the plugins one by one to see which plugin is conflicting if any.

     

    Best regards,
    Shufflehound team

    ScienceofRowing
    Participant

    Hello. Thank you. I updated the theme and went through each plugin. The JQuery issue is now resolved.

    My site load time is still very slow and the “Active PHP session” error is still present on my Site Health screen.

    http://www.scienceofrowing.com

     

    Attachments:
    You must be logged in to view attached files.

    My site load time is still very slow

    There can be various other reasons why your site is loading slow as described in the following pages.

     

    https://www.bitcatcha.com/blog/2015/10-frustrating-reasons-why-your-website-speed-is-slow/

    https://www.pickaweb.co.uk/kb/website-running-slow/

    https://gtmetrix.com/why-is-my-page-slow.html

     

    You can improve your site performance as described in the following pages.

     

    http://www.wpbeginner.com/wordpress-performance-speed/

    https://codex.wordpress.org/WordPress_Optimization/WordPress_Performance

    https://wpengine.com/blog/page-speed-wordpress-performance/

    https://themetrust.com/test-wordpress-site-performance/

     

    To optimize images and load them faster, you can use any of the following plugins.

     

    https://wordpress.org/plugins/ewww-image-optimizer/

    https://wordpress.org/plugins/wp-smushit/

    and the “Active PHP session” error is still present on my Site Health screen.

    Have you troubleshot it for the plugin conflict as described in my earlier reply?

    ScienceofRowing
    Participant

    Thank you for those links. I will work through those. We are using EWW Image Optimizer already.

    and the “Active PHP session” error is still present on my Site Health screen.

    Have you troubleshot it for the plugin conflict as described in my earlier reply?

    Ah, I was under the impression that I was testing the plugin conflict against the JQuery issue, not against the active PHP session. Do I now understand you correctly that I should go through each plugin activation again checking it against the active PHP session error?

     Do I now understand you correctly that I should go through each plugin activation again checking it against the active PHP session error?

    Yes

    ScienceofRowing
    Participant

    Thanks. The “Active PHP session” error is still there even with all plugins deactivated except for Redux, Unyson, and WP Bakery Pagebuilder.

    Then it seems the server related issue so could you please contact your web host to resolve it?

    ScienceofRowing
    Participant

    Okay, thanks for the help.

    You are most welcome here 🙂

    ScienceofRowing
    Participant

    Hi again,

    I went through each plugin, starting from zero plugins this time instead of leaving Bakery, Unyson, and Redux intact. The Unyson plugin is causing my errors. As soon as I deactivated it, my site times sped up, the “active PHP session” error went away, and another formatting problem resolved too. I reactivated Unyson and the error(s) returned.

    From further searching, it seems that at least one other person has had this problem too with the active PHP session error.

     

    https://github.com/ThemeFuse/Unyson/issues/4042

     

    https://wordpress.org/support/topic/critical-issue-active-php-session/page/2/

     

    Can you please advise on a fix?

    Solution for this topic

    Awesome great to see you got the issue found.

     

    You can resolve the issue as described in the below reply.

     

    https://github.com/ThemeFuse/Unyson/issues/4042#issuecomment-681862373

    ScienceofRowing
    Participant

    Where do I find “the theme functions.php file” described in that answer, please?

    You will find it as shown in the attached screenshot.

    Attachments:
    You must be logged in to view attached files.

    ScienceofRowing
    Participant

    Thank you! That worked. The PHP error is resolved and my site health is back to “good” status. Thanks so much for the help.

    Resolved.

    You are always welcome here 🙂

Viewing 16 posts - 1 through 16 (of 16 total)